5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

This term refers to sensational writing which is used to lure and enrage readers, and thus cause them to buy more newspapers. Joseph Pulitzer and William Randolph Hearst utilized this style of journalism in their discussion of events in Cuba, fueling the desire for war with Spain in America.

Back

Yellow Journalism
